Daniel Defense MK18 RIII Compact Assault Rifle
The Daniel Defense MK18 RIII is a compact, combat-focused rifle built for close quarters battle and modern tactical environments. Based on the proven MK18 platform used by special operations forces, this updated configuration integrates the RIS III rail system for improved modularity and heat management. Chambered in 5.56 NATO, it is designed for speed, control, and reliability in confined spaces where maneuverability is critical. The short barrel design makes it highly effective in urban operations, vehicle-based engagements, and rapid deployment scenarios.
Manufacturer
The MK18 RIII is manufactured by Daniel Defense, a U.S.-based firearms company known for precision engineering and military-grade AR-platform rifles. The company has supplied rifles to U.S. special operations units and law enforcement agencies, with a reputation for tight quality control and durable construction. The MK18 lineage itself traces back to SOCOM requirements for a shortened carbine optimized for close-range combat.
Speed and Range
The MK18 RIII features a 10.3 inch cold hammer forged barrel, prioritizing compactness over long-range engagement. Muzzle velocity averages around 2,600 to 2,800 feet per second depending on ammunition type. Effective range is typically 200 to 300 meters, making it best suited for short to medium distance engagements. The rifle maintains high cyclic efficiency with semi-automatic and fully automatic configurations available depending on setup. The RIS III handguard improves cooling and allows for modern optics, suppressors, and tactical accessories.
Cost / Price
In the civilian and law enforcement market, the Daniel Defense MK18 RIII generally falls in the premium category. Pricing typically ranges between 2,200 and 2,800 USD depending on configuration, accessories, and retailer. Its cost reflects its materials, manufacturing standards, and operational pedigree rather than mass-market positioning.
